German-Style Chicken Hash
A hearty German-inspired dish made with crispy chicken, hash browns, and a robust blend of herbs.
Ingredients
- ●1 pound chicken breastboneless and skinless
- ●1 cup hash brownsshredded and pan-fried
- ●2 tablespoons robust coffee rubhomemade or store-bought
- ●1/4 cup grassy fresh parsleychopped and fresh
- ●1/2 cup american cheddar cheeseshredded and melted
- ●2 tablespoons olive oilfor frying
- ●to taste salt and pepper
Instructions
- 1
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
- 2
Add the chicken breast and cook for 5-6 minutes per side, or until cooked through.
- 3
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side to rest.
- 4
Add the remaining 1 tablespoon of olive oil to the skillet and sauté the hash browns until crispy.
- 5
Sprinkle the robust coffee rub over the hash browns and stir to combine.
- 6
Return the chicken to the skillet and top with shredded cheddar cheese.
- 7
Cook for an additional 1-2 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- 8
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ot.
